MIXCLOUD: Live from Monorail City Vol 3: Metal Beats 1978-82
The latest transmission from Monorail City draws on the city's past as an Industrial powerhouse and Techno heartland. This mix documents the roots of Techno, featuring Synth-Pop classics from the period 1978-82, tracks which would inspire the Electro and Techno movements to follow. Includes early tracks from Ryuichi Sakamoto and his Japanese YMO pals, German industrial from Kraftwerk and Liaisons Dangereuses, UK synth-pop from John Foxx, Gary Numan and The Human League - plus the first Detroit Techno tracks from 1981. All massive hits in the clubs of Monorail City...
